Harvey Weinstein Convicted of Rape and Sexual Assault

Harvey Weinstein has been convicted of third-degree rape and a first-degree criminal sexual act. The charges are based on testimonies involving oral sex in 2006 and rape in 2013. The 67-year-old film producer was however acquitted on two serious counts of predatory sexual assault and one count of rape in the first degree. Weinstein, who faces up to 25 years in prison, will be sentenced on March 11.

The World Pays Tribute to Kobe Bryant

At least 20,000 people flocked Staples Centre on Monday in celebration of Kobe and Gianna Bryant. Millions more got to watch the live event through various media across the world. Vanessa Bryant opened up on the pain of losing her loved ones, describing daughter Gianna as "an amazingly sweet and gentle soul". She also talked about "girl dad" Kobe and their 21-year relationship. Beyoncé, Alicia Keys, Shaquille O'Neal and Michael Jordan were among celebrity attendees at the event. Kobe and Gianna died alongside seven others in a helicopter crash January 26th.
